What Does a Mortgage Lender in Kahului Cost?

Typical costs for a mortgage lender in Hawaii include an origination fee of 0.5% to 1% of the loan amount, appraisal fees of $500 to $800, and title insurance of $1,500 to $3,000. Closing costs in Kahului often total 2% to 5% of the purchase price. This is general information, not mortgage or financial advice.

Frequently Asked Questions

What documents do I need to apply for a mortgage in Kahului?
You typically need pay stubs, tax returns, bank statements, and a valid ID. For Hawaii loans, you may also need a leasehold agreement or condominium documents if applicable.
How long does it take to close a mortgage in Hawaii?
Closing usually takes 30 to 45 days from application. Hawaii law requires a title search and escrow process, which can add a few days compared to mainland states.
Are there special loan programs for Hawaii residents?
Yes, the Hawaii Housing Finance and Development Corporation offers down payment assistance and low-interest loans for qualified buyers. USDA loans are also available for rural areas on Maui.
